I have always thought that the C3's and C4's were made in Sweden, but on another site someone said they were made in China. I know the BCX's are made in China and the Revo's are made in Korea.  |

Hio...you can tell whomever it is at "another" site, that they are mis-informed. The 45/55/65/35/56/66 C3/C4's are still Swedish made.
The BCX is a total piece of crap. The spool axles fail. And then they want to charge 45.00 for a spool that came out of a 69.00 reel.

The box for my 7000C3 says that it’s “Made in Taiwan Designed and inspected according to Abu Garcia’s specifications.”
Not that I think it makes a real difference (no pun intended). As long as the specifications delivered to the Asian plant are good and the cost of quality materials is authorized then there’s no reason a great reel can’t come from there. For example, my 7000C3 has served me well for several years of striper, bluefish, and cod catching. |
